Retatrutide Structure and Chemistry Retatrutide builds on the engineering principles refined in semaglutide and tirzepatide: Glucagon-based peptide backbone retatrutide is derived from glucagon, with modifications to give it activity at all three target receptors Strategic amino acid substitutions multiple substitutions tune the receptor activity balance across GLP-1R, GIPR, and glucagon receptor Fatty acid chain attached for albumin binding and extended half-life (similar strategy to semaglutide and tirzepatide) Aminoisobutyric acid substitutions protect against DPP-4 enzymatic degradation The triple-agonist design is technically demanding because each receptor has different binding requirements
